Transaction 023898754c300a9c66608c98b9b196af937d8c98853dbecd77bfac97a182b566
1 Input
1 Output
-
023898754c300a9c66608c98b9b196af937d8c98853dbecd77bfac97a182b566:0
- value
- 33903573
- script pubkey
- OP_0 OP_PUSHBYTES_20 018fe32868faae970d88613797908bb118cd2771
- address
- bc1qqx87x2rgl2hfwrvgvyme0yytkyvv6fm39xnesx